Technology is evolving at a breakneck pace, and 2025 is shaping up to be a pivotal year for entrepreneurs. From artificial intelligence to automation, staying informed about these trends is crucial for business success. Let’s delve into the most impactful technology trends that are set to redefine the entrepreneurial landscape.
AI and machine learning are no longer futuristic concepts; they’re integral to modern business operations. In 2025, these technologies will further streamline processes, enhance customer experiences, and provide data-driven insights.
Key Applications:
Customer Service: AI-powered chatbots offer 24/7 support, improving customer satisfaction.
Data Analysis: Machine learning algorithms analyze vast datasets to identify trends and patterns.
Personalization: AI tailors marketing strategies to individual customer preferences.
Example: A small e-commerce business uses AI to recommend products based on customer browsing history, leading to increased sales.
Automation is revolutionizing industries by handling repetitive tasks, allowing entrepreneurs to focus on strategic growth.
Benefits:
Efficiency: Automated systems perform tasks faster and with fewer errors.
Cost Savings: Reduces the need for manual labor, lowering operational costs.
Scalability: Easily scale operations without proportional increases in workforce.

The rollout of 5G networks is set to transform how businesses operate, offering faster and more reliable internet connections.
Impacts:
Enhanced Communication: Supports high-quality video conferencing and real-time collaboration.
IoT Expansion: Facilitates the growth of connected devices, improving data collection and analysis.
Remote Work: Enables seamless remote operations, a necessity in today’s business environment.
Blockchain offers secure and transparent transactions, making it invaluable for entrepreneurs concerned with data integrity.
Applications:
Smart Contracts: Automate agreements, reducing the need for intermediaries.
Supply Chain Management: Track products from origin to delivery, ensuring authenticity.
Financial Transactions: Facilitate secure and fast cross-border payments. bbntimes.com
Note: While blockchain is promising, it’s essential to stay updated on regulatory developments affecting its implementation.
IoT connects devices, allowing for real-time data collection and analysis, which is crucial for informed decision-making.
Advantages:
Operational Efficiency: Monitor equipment and processes to prevent downtime.
Customer Insights: Gather data on product usage to improve offerings.
Energy Management: Optimize energy consumption, reducing costs.
Example: A retail store uses IoT sensors to monitor foot traffic, adjusting staffing and inventory accordingly.
As businesses become more digital, cybersecurity is paramount to protect sensitive information.
Strategies:
Multi-Factor Authentication (MFA): Adds an extra layer of security beyond passwords.
Regular Updates: Keep software and systems up-to-date to patch vulnerabilities.
Employee Training: Educate staff on recognizing and preventing cyber threats.
Insight: Implementing robust cybersecurity measures is not just about technology but also about fostering a culture of security awareness.
Cloud services offer scalable and flexible solutions for data storage and application deployment.
Benefits:
Cost-Effective: Pay for what you use, reducing infrastructure costs.
Accessibility: Access data and applications from anywhere with an internet connection.
Collaboration: Facilitate teamwork through shared resources and tools.
Tip: Choose a reputable cloud service provider that meets your business’s specific needs and compliance requirements.
AR and VR technologies are enhancing customer experiences and training methods across various industries.
Use Cases:
Product Visualization: Allow customers to see products in their environment before purchasing.
Employee Training: Simulate real-world scenarios for effective learning.
Marketing Campaigns: Create immersive experiences to engage customers. theverge.com
Example: A furniture retailer uses AR to let customers visualize how a sofa would look in their living room.
Edge computing processes data closer to its source, reducing latency and improving speed.
Advantages:
Real-Time Data Processing: Essential for applications requiring immediate responses.
Bandwidth Optimization: Reduces the amount of data transmitted to central servers.
Enhanced Security: Keeps sensitive data closer to its source, minimizing exposure.
Insight: Edge computing is particularly beneficial for industries like manufacturing and healthcare, where timely data processing is critical.
Quantum computing, though still in its early stages, holds the potential to solve complex problems beyond the capabilities of classical computers.
Potential Applications:
Drug Discovery: Accelerate the development of new medications.
Financial Modeling: Improve risk assessment and investment strategies.
Cryptography: Enhance data encryption methods. theaustralian

Artificial Intelligence (AI) continues to be the most transformative, offering tools for automation, customer engagement, and data analysis.
By adopting 5G, small businesses can enhance remote work capabilities, improve communication, and integrate more IoT devices for better data insights.
While blockchain offers benefits like transparency and security, its applicability depends on the specific needs and resources of a business.
IoT devices can be vulnerable to cyberattacks if not properly secured. It’s essential to implement strong security protocols and regular updates.
Edge computing processes data locally, reducing latency, while cloud computing relies on centralized data centers. The choice depends on the specific requirements of the application.
Staying abreast of technological advancements is no longer optional for entrepreneurs; it’s a necessity. By understanding and integrating these trends, businesses can enhance efficiency, improve customer experiences, and maintain a competitive edge.
